Battered Cod Fish Tacos

Battered Cod Fish Tacos feature fresh cod fish sliced into strips, coated in a seasoned batter made with flour, baking powder, spices, and root beer, then deep-fried to a golden crisp. Served on warm corn tortillas, the tacos are topped with a tangy cabbage slaw and a fresh avocado salsa, adding texture and brightness that balance the richness of the fried fish. This combination provides a lively and satisfying taco experience.

Description

This recipe creates battered cod fish tacos using fresh cod fillets sliced into uniform strips and dipped in a batter composed of all-purpose flour, baking powder, ground mustard, garlic and onion powders, salt, black pepper, and root beer. The root beer in the batter likely adds a mild sweetness and carbonation to aid in achieving a crispy coating. The fish strips are deep-fried in vegetable oil heated to 350°F until golden brown on each side, resulting in a light and crisp exterior.

The tacos are assembled on corn tortillas and complemented with two fresh toppings: a simple slaw made from shredded green cabbage tossed with red wine vinegar, salt, and pepper, and an avocado salsa blending diced tomatoes, white onion, cilantro, avocado, lime juice, and salt. These fresh elements add acidity, creaminess, and herbaceous notes, enhancing the fried fish's flavor and texture.

This dish balances crunchy, creamy, tangy, and fresh components providing a full range of textures and flavors. It makes a flavorful maleable meal for lunch or dinner that showcases the cod in a casual yet layered preparation.

Ingredients

Servings
  • vegetable oil for frying
  • 1 pound cod fresh
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on ground mustard
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 cup root beer
  • 4 Roma tomato diced
  • 1/2 white onion minced
  • 1/4 cilantro chopped, fresh leaves
  • 2 avocado diced
  • 2 lime juiced
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 2 cups green cabbage shredded
  • 1/2 cup red wine vinegar
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 16 corn tortillas

Instructions

  1. Pour vegetable oil into a large heavy skillet, using enough to cover the bottom with 1/2-1 inch of oil. Heat to 350 degrees.
  2. Meanwhile, slice your fish into 1/2 inch wide strips, 5 inches long. In a medium-size mixing bowl, make your batter by whisking together flour, baking powder, mustard,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, pepper, and root beer. Set aside.
  3. Make your avocado salsa by combining diced tomatoes, onion, cilantro, avocados, lime juice, and salt in a bowl. Toss together to combine.
  4. Make your simple slaw by tossing together shredded cabbage with red wine vinegar. Season generously with salt and pepper, to taste.
  5. Working in batches, dip fish into the prepared batter to coat. Place directly into the 350 degree oil. Fry until deep, golden brown, about 3 to 4 minutes per side. Let drain on a paper-towel lined plate.
  6. Serve fried fish hot on a corn tortilla. Top with slaw, avocado salsa, and jalapeno crema.
